
Cost of Structural Reinforcement in Dallas
The cost of structural reinforcement in Dallas, TX, can vary significantly based on a range of factors. Whether you're reinforcing a residential property or a commercial building, understanding these variables can help you budget more effectively and ensure the longevity and safety of your structure.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Reinforcement: Different reinforcement methods such as steel beams, carbon fiber, or concrete can have varying costs.
- Building Size: Larger buildings typically require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ials often come at a premium but offer better durability and performance.
- Labor Costs: Skilled labor rates in Dallas, TX, can vary, influencing the total project c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-access areas may require specialized equipment or additional labor, raising costs.
- Project Timeline: Expedited projects may incur higher labor costs due to overtime or additional shifts.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ost Range (Dallas, TX) |
---|---|
Steel Beam Installation | $1,500 - $5,000 |
Carbon Fiber Reinforcement |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Concrete Reinforcement | $2,500 - $7,500 |
Foundation Repair |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Wall Bracing | $1,200 - $4,000 |
Floor Joist Reinforcement |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Seismic Retrofitting | $5,000 - $20,000 |
Structural Inspections | $300 - $800 |
